What Are Amazon WorkSpaces Core Managed Instances?

Amazon WorkSpaces Core Managed Instances are a powerful tool designed to simplify the deployment and management of virtual desktops in the cloud. This service allows organizations to efficiently provision, manage, and scale their desktop resources within the AWS ecosystem. The managed instances support both persistent (always-on) and non-persistent (on-demand) workloads, providing flexibility in how organizations deploy their virtual desktops.

Key Components of WorkSpaces Core Managed Instances:

  • Customization: Tailor instance configurations to meet specific business needs.
  • Lifecycle Management: Simplified lifecycle management for VDI environments.
  • Security: Operates within the security framework of AWS accounts.

Key Features of Amazon WorkSpaces Core

Amazon WorkSpaces Core offers a range of features that make it stand out in the virtual desktop market.

1. Customizable Configurations

  • Multiple instance types available based on compute, memory, and graphics needs.
  • Choose from accelerated graphics instances for graphics-intensive applications.

2. Lifecycle Management

  • Automates infrastructure lifecycle management, reducing operational complexity.
  • Integrates neatly with existing VDI solutions for seamless transitions.

3. Cost-Effective Solutions

  • Allows the use of Savings Plans and On-Demand Capacity Reservations (ODCRs).
  • Supports existing discounts for cost optimization.

4. Enhanced Security

  • Provides a secure environment adhering to strict governance policies.
  • Simple integration with existing AWS security protocols.

5. Partner Solutions

  • Supports integration with partners like Citrix, Workspot, and Leostream for robust desktop experiences.

AWS Regions Offering WorkSpaces Core Managed Instances

As of October 2025, Amazon WorkSpaces Core Managed Instances are now available in the following AWS Regions:

  1. US East (Ohio)
  2. Asia Pacific (Malaysia)
  3. Asia Pacific (Hong Kong)
  4. Middle East (UAE)
  5. Europe (Spain)

Benefits of Regional Availability

  • Reduced latency for users located near these regions.
  • Compliance with regional laws and regulations concerning data residency.

Cost Optimization Strategies

Implementing Amazon WorkSpaces Core Managed Instances can be financially beneficial when optimized effectively. Here are strategies to maximize your cost-efficiency:

1. Utilize Savings Plans

  • Enroll in AWS Savings Plans to reduce costs significantly through commitment to usage.

2. Take Advantage of On-Demand Capacity Reservations

  • Use ODCRs to reserve capacity for expected workload increases without incurring unnecessary costs.

3. Optimize Resource Allocation

  • Regularly review instance types and configurations to ensure they align with workload demands.

4. Monitor Usage

  • Employ AWS CloudWatch to monitor usage patterns, adjusting resource allocations as necessary.
